Westfield Selling Five Assets in U.S. for US$1.1 Billion
21 Décembre 2015 - 12:07AM
Dow Jones News
By Robb M. Stewart
MELBOURNE, Australia--Shopping-center owner Westfield Corp.
(WFD.AU) has sold five assets in the U.S. for US$1.1 billion, part
of its strategy to narrow its focus on flagship operations in
leading markets.
Proceeds from the sale will be used initially to pay down debt
and will be redeployed in time toward Westfield's US$11.4 billion
development program, the company said Monday.
